EAU CLAIRE — President Bush calls for a return to normalcy, Mayor Rudolph Giuliani invites us all to Manhattan, and the University of Wisconsin-Eau Claire's art department declares it your duty to join their annual spring trip to New York.
An informational meeting will be held at 7 p.m. Tuesday, Nov. 6, in Room 105 of the Haas Fine Arts Center.
The annual trip, scheduled to leave at 4 p.m. Friday, March 21, 2002, and return on Sunday, March 31, is an opportunity for students, faculty and community members to explore art, music, theater, food and the sights of Manhattan and the Burroughs.
The cost of the trip includes round-trip motor coach transportation and seven nights in either double or quad rooms in a mid-town hotel located just a couple blocks from Central Park. Although not a guided tour, there are optional group activities planned most days. Participants can purchase a 7-day pass for unlimited subway and bus rides for $17.
The per-person cost is $500 with student ID (quads), $550 for all others (quads) or $750 for doubles. Tickets are available now at the University Service Center in Davies Center or by phone, 836-3727. Deadline for purchasing tickets is Feb. 18, 2002.
Everyone is invited to the informational meeting. For details, call the UW-Eau Claire art department at 836-3277.
